Title

Policyholders’ perspectives on operating Motor Insurance Policies by Oriental Insurance Company

Abstract

Abstract Motor insurance contributes to one third of the premium income for the General Insurance industry in India. The growth of the economy and consequently, the standard of living of the people, further supported by the increased choice for the customer and entry of large number of automobile players led to a sharp increase in motor insurance. The main aim of the motor insurance is to protect the people from the loss arising out of accident. It covers loss made vehicle. The awareness of the people towards Insurance is low in India generally it is very difficult to create the buying attitude among the prospective buyers towards the different kinds of insurance. The General Insurance Corporation finds it difficult to identify and to make the clients believe the concepts of Insurance Policy. At the same time, the policy will be valued for only one year. The lack of insurance awareness is the main problem in general insurance particularly in motor insurance. Vehicle owners buy it only on the compulsion of the financing institution and regional transports office where the vehicle is registered. It is a mandatory provision that every vehicle owner should take a motor policy. Hence a study on motor insurance of the Oriental Insurance Company Limited in Sivakasi is carried out to analyze the policyholder’s attitude. The present study has been undertaken with the primary objective of analyzing the attitude of the policyholder’s towards Motor Insurance Company in the study area. The investigation encompassed an extensive survey to obtain primary data from sample respondents of 50 respondents’ customers in sivakasi. The interview schedule covered all the activities related to personal data, details about motor insurance and the suggestion for improvement of motor insurance. Based on the findings of the study, the OIC is suggested to introduce new products, advertise the benefits of taking the motor insurance policy, introduce on-line premium payment portals and introduce on-line renewal system and the like. These kinds of studies will surely kindle a competitive environment for General Insurance Industry. *******
